CARAMEL MORSEL BARS



Caramel Morsel Bars image

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Recipes

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 6

49 (14 oz. bag) KRAFT Caramels
3 Tablespoons water
5 cups crisp rice cereal
1 cup peanuts (I use right from a can and separate halves)
1 pkg (6 oz.) (1 cup) semi-sweet real chocolate morsels
1 pkg (6 oz.) (1 cup) butterscotch flavored morsels

Steps:

  • Melt caramels with water in saucepan over low heat. Stir frequently until sauce is smooth. Pour over cereal and nuts; toss until well coated.
  • With greased fingers, press mixture into greased 13 X 9-inch baking pan. Sprinkle morsels on top.
  • Place in 200 degree oven for 5 minutes, or until morsels soften. Spread softened morsels until blended to form a frosting. Cool; cut into bars.

CARAMEL MORSEL BARS



Caramel Morsel Bars image

Had these at a wedding shower and they were so yummy! My friend said she clipped this recipe from a Kraft advertisement that appeared in a magazine about 30 years ago. She uses rice krisp cereal so not sure what it would be like with a toasted oat cereal.

Provided by teapotter

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 15m

Yield 30 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 (14 ounce) bag caramels
3 tablespoons water
5 cups crisp rice cereal or 5 cups toasted oat cereal
1 cup peanuts
1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 cup butterscotch chips

Steps:

  • Melt caramels with water in a saucepan over low heat. Stir frequently till caramels are melted and sauce is smooth.
  • Toss cereal and peanuts together in a bowl. Pour the melted caramel sauce over the mixture and toss until well coated.
  • With buttered fingers, press the mixture into a greased 13 x 9 inch baking pan. Sprinkle chocolate and butterscotch chips on top and place in a 200F oven for about 5 minutes or until chips are softened. Spread the softened chips to blend slightly and form a frosting over the top. Cool and cut into bars. Cut into 30 bars or in sizes as desired.

CHOCOLATE BUTTERSCOTCH CARAMEL BARS



Chocolate Butterscotch Caramel Bars image

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 4h5m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

Nonstick cooking spray, for spraying the pan
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 1/2 cups regular or quick oats
1 cup packed brown sugar
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1 3/4 sticks (14 tablespoons) cold salted butter, cut into pieces
Two 13.5-ounce cans dulce de leche (I used Nestle La Lechera)
About 1 cup Spanish peanuts
About 1 cup butterscotch chips
About 1 cup mini ch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line a 9-inch square baking pan with aluminum foil and spray with nonstick spray.
  • Mix together the flour, oats, brown sugar, baking powder and salt in a bowl. Cut in the butter with a pastry cutter until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Sprinkle the mixture into the prepared pan and pat lightly to pack it slightly.
  • Bake until light golden brown on top and done in the middle, watching to make sure it doesn't burn, 30 to 35 minutes. Allow to cool for 15 minutes.
  • Spoon the dulce de leche into a microwave-safe bowl and microwave to just slightly soften it, about 45 seconds. Scoop it on top of the oatmeal base and use an offset spatula to spread it out to the edges and into an even layer. Sprinkle on a layer of peanuts so that they completely cover the caramel and use your hands to gently press them into the caramel. Sprinkle on the butterscotch chips and mini chocolate chips in generous layers.
  • Note: The warmth of the cookie base and caramel should slightly soften the butterscotch and chocolate chips. When that happens, use your hands to very gently press the chips just enough to anchor them together (but not enough to misshape them). If the pan isn't warm enough, pop it into the oven for 30 seconds or so and gently press the chips to anchor them together.
  • Chill the bars for 2 to 3 hours to make them easy to slice. Remove them from the pan, place on a cutting board and use a long serrated knife to cut into small squares (they're rich!). Serve cold or at room temperature.

CHOCOLATE-PEANUT-BUTTER-CARAMEL CEREAL BARS



Chocolate-Peanut-Butter-Caramel Cereal Bars image

Here's a risk-free way to get rich quick: Try our easy take on the classic chocolate-caramel butter bars known as millionaire's shortbread. We swap in crispy, marshmallow-laden rice cereal for its base, and add a thin layer of peanut-butter caramel under the chocolate-shell topping. Just invest a little time to let it chill, and it pays off with every extravagant bite.

Provided by Riley Wofford

Categories     Cookie Recipes

Time 1h15m

Yield Makes 16

Number Of Ingredients 8

8 tablespoons unsalted butter, divided, plus more for pan
1 bag (10 ounces) mini marshmallows
Pinch of flaky sea salt, such as Jacobsen or Maldon, plus more for sprinkling
4 cups puffed-rice cereal
3/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up heavy cream
3/4 cup creamy peanut butter
3 ounces bittersweet chocolate, chopped (2/3 cup)

Steps:

  • Brush a 9-inch square baking pan with butter; line with parchment, leaving a 2-inch overhang on two sides. Melt 3 tablespoons butter in a pot over medium heat. Add marshmallows and salt; cook, stirring, until melted. Remove from heat; stir in cereal. Press mixture into prepared pan in an even layer. Let cool 15 minutes.
  • In a small saucepan, combine sugar and 3 tablespoons water. Cover and cook over medium heat, swirling pan a few times, until sugar has dissolved and mixture comes to a boil. Uncover and cook, undisturbed, until mixture turns amber, about 3 minutes more. Remove from heat. Carefully add cream and 2 tablespoons butter (it will bubble up); stir until smooth. Let cool completely, about 1 hour. Whisk in peanut butter. Spread mixture evenly over crust and refrigerate until firm, about 30 minutes.
  • Melt chocolate and remaining 3 tablespoons butter in a small heat-proof bowl set over (but not in) a pot of simmering water, stirring until smooth. Spread evenly over caramel layer. Let stand 5 minutes, then sprinkle with salt and refrigerate until set, at least 30 minutes and up to 24 hours. Lift from pan using overhangs. Using a serrated knife, cut into squares. Refrigerate in an airtight container between pieces of parchment up to 3 days.
